Transaction 33125d69fc8928e4a1de9a2e1b76dd04e3c1799e20f45f12e2a4869a9d80951e

7 Input
2 Outputs
  • 33125d69fc8928e4a1de9a2e1b76dd04e3c1799e20f45f12e2a4869a9d80951e:0
  • value  27796510
    address  19X5XAQWofERDc5YTkkfKPyuVhs4fLpXTV
  • 33125d69fc8928e4a1de9a2e1b76dd04e3c1799e20f45f12e2a4869a9d80951e:1
  • value  7471667
    address  35ZXRGxfHk86anS7YkhNtQQph7RzQ3UyMF